У меня есть общая проблема, которую я обычно решал с помощью locals
, но на этот раз не работает.Как передать переменные в частичные?
У меня есть следующий блок:
<% @user.followers.each do |follower| %>
<%= render "follower_card" %>
<% end %>
И следующий частичный:
<div class="row follower-card">
<%= image_tag follower.avatar_url(:smallthumb), class: "col-4 inline avatar_medium circle" %>
<ul class="col-8 inline">
<li><%= follower.name %></li>
<li><%= follower.location %></li>
<li class="lightgray small inline"><span class="bold"><%= follower.photos.count %></span> Spots</li> -
<li class="lightgray small inline"><span class="bold"><%= follower.albums.count %></span> Spotbooks</li>
</ul>
</div>
Я получаю следующее сообщение об ошибке:
undefined local variable or method `follower' for #<#<Class:0x007fe791a4c8d0>:0x007fe799b14b98>